To genuinely value the crucial role of a Level 2 electrician, it's vital to comprehend the scope of their work. Unlike a general electrician who primarily manages internal circuitry within a building, a Level 2 specialist is licensed to deal with the service mains. This includes whatever from the power pole or underground pit right as much as the service fuse and meter box on a premise. This encompasses a broad variety of jobs that are essential for both new connections and maintaining existing ones.
Consider the circumstance of a recently developed home. Before the lights can even flicker on, a Level 2 electrician is needed. They are responsible for establishing the service connection, installing the service main cable, and guaranteeing it's securely and correctly linked to the network's point of supply. This involves navigating complex policies website and sticking to strict security protocols, as they are dealing with high-voltage electrical energy directly from the grid. Their work makes sure that when the power is turned on, it flows safely and reliably to the residential or commercial property.

Moreover, these experts play a crucial role in upgrading electrical facilities. As our energy requires progress, with the increasing adoption of photovoltaic panels, electric lorry charging stations, and other high-demand home appliances, existing service mains might need to be upgraded to accommodate the increased load. A Level 2 electrician examines the current capacity, figures out the required upgrades, and skillfully sets up bigger cables or modifies existing connections to ensure the residential or commercial property can handle the new power needs without risk of overload or fire.
Their knowledge also encompasses more nuanced scenarios, such as managing momentary power supplies for construction websites or events. They are accountable for establishing and dismantling these connections, ensuring they meet all safety standards and are capable of dealing with the short-term load. This precise planning and execution avoid mishaps and make sure continuous power for important operations.
